Output 143789d403511c5a08dcfe23648f6b46d3bff19624a1144d54f458886a989219:1

value
644678600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5947f873f7795cc949ec6df1e6a7c72adf0a551f OP_EQUAL
address
MG3Eb6tvKuHTgoan5n7DfNGHUfRFWQrXes
transaction
143789d403511c5a08dcfe23648f6b46d3bff19624a1144d54f458886a989219
spent
true